So the advice they gave me was only serve canned food until the kitty was feeling back to normal. i guess it is easier to digest and less likely to dehydrate them. Try that with your kitty that won’t eat. I have also heard and been told that if your kitty won’t go number 2 you can try canned pumpkin. The kind that is pure pumpkin, not the spiced up pie filling. Feed a small amount and that will bulk up the stools and sometimes help push out any blockages. Try that but also call your vet. Good luck!!
